Re: how to get to swat

2002-11-19 Thread Daniel Jarboe
If root /pass doesn't work for you (still get 401), you can set
server_args = -a to disable authentication.  Obviously this is a last
resort kind of thing, and you definitely want your only_from = address
set, and the swat service disabled pretty much always :).  That being
said, root _should_ work "out of the box", but I've heard in some cases
-a was the only method some people could get in.

Re: how to get to swat

2002-11-18 Thread James Tison
SWAT is a really nice application that aids in Samba administration. I'd
never understood the format & requirements of a minimal smb.conf file until
I'd run SWAT for a while. I still run it: it's easier than having to read
the documentation all the time, and even if you still need doc references,
SWAT points you right at them, field by field. Really thoughtful tool.

Re: how to get to swat

2002-11-18 Thread Kittendorf, Craig
Has Samba been started?

Do you have
swat  901/tcp
in /etc/services?

And
   swat  stream  tcp nowait  root   /usr/bin/swat swat
In /etc/inetd.conf?

Re: how to get to swat

2002-11-18 Thread Jon R. Doyle
Edit inetd.conf and uncomment the lines to allow SWAT to run, be sure inetd
is running, it should be in rc.config as start inetd=yes, you can call it
with "rcinetd start"
